Mark Twain's THE PRINCE AND THE PAUPER by Jonathan Bolt directed by Nicholas C. Avila February 9-25, 2007 Julianne Argyros Stage
Long ago, in the ancient city of London, the king has a son — Prince Edward VII! Someday the world will be at his feet. On that very day, a lout in dirty rags has a son he names Tom. Fifteen years later, the boys meet by chance, notice how much they resemble each other, and decide to exchange clothing for fun. Soon, their make-believe turns into reality. Imagine how their worlds change when the boys must walk in each other’s shoes — literally!
